Joyce Miller Wells
January 15th, 1933 - October 4th, 2025
Joyce Wells of Colorado Springs peacefully went home early October 2025. Born in Durant, Oklahoma, Joyce was the cherished only child of Wayne and Elsie Miller, who named her “Joyce” because she brought them such joy from the very beginning.
Her early years were shaped by her father’s work as a civil engineer, leading the family to live in many places. They settled in East Tennessee from 1941 to 1950 where Joyce graduated from Oak Ridge High School. The family later returned to Oklahoma where Joyce earned a degree in art education from the University of Oklahoma in 1954. Her love for learning and teaching led her to pursue a master’s degree in elementary education from the University of Denver. Joyce was a teacher throughout various times in her life, sharing her passion for reading and helping countless children discover the magic of books.
In 1953, Joyce met the love of her life, Frank David Wells, at a statewide conference of Disciples Student Fellowship college students. On their first date they discovered a shared love of square dancing that sparked a lifelong partnership. They were married on June 16, 1956, in Tulsa, Oklahoma. During their marriage they moved to Denver, Colorado and later to Los Alamos, New Mexico where they raised a family. After retirement they settled in Colorado Springs. There they became active members of the International Dance Club, where they spent many joyful years dancing side by side.
Joyce’s creativity and grace extended into her hobbies-she found joy in sewing, weaving, quilting, and playing the piano. She served as the pianist for Bryce Avenue Presbyterian Church and Covenant Christian School in Los Alamos, offering her musical gifts to uplift others.
She is preceded in death by her beloved husband, David. She is survived by her daughter, Mary Kearns; son, Chris (Yolanda) Wells; sister-in-law, Lola Moore; grandchildren, Zack Wells, Kyla (Andrew) Kepson, Devin and Jessica Kearns; and great-grandchildren Aubreelynn Wells, Thayer and Alden Kepson, all of whom will continue to cherish her memory.
A committal service to honor Joyce’s life and reunite her with her beloved husband will be held at Evergreen Cemetery at Lot 210 on Monday October 27, 2025 at 11 am. Weather permitting coffee will be served at 10:30 am.
